I just bought my son the Orbit Extreme sky blue.  He just made 11 and he's a junior bowler and has been bowling just 1 year.  I had a deal with him that when he gets his first 200 game, I will get him a ball of his choice.  He bowed a 203 3 weeks ago, so that day, we went into the proshop and asked the operator to recommend a ball for him.  He suggested this ball and my son said ok.  Out of all the pretty pearl balls that he could choose from, plus his friend just picked up a "pretty" Twisted Fury, I was surprised that he wanted the Orbit Extreme.  He just got it this past Thursday and threw a few practice games with it and he just loves it!  Very nice ball reaction, much stronger that his Tropical Storm, and the ball hits very hard.  He has a 119 average, and his first game was a 124.  Finished with a 155, 160, and a 179, all way above his average.  I'm glad that he made a choice based on the proshop operators opinion (I showed him some of the reviews on this ball and other balls as well) and not just wanting to get a ball with "flash".  Now I got to get him a 2 ball bag.
